SpletIf you are undergoing chemotherapy for cancer treatment, it is usually recommended that you wear a condom for at least two days after treatment during any type of intercourse (vaginal, anal, or oral). 1 Your healthcare provider may even advise for a longer time period. Splet24. feb. 2024 · If you are cleaning up the body fluids of a chemotherapy patient, wear gloves and wash your hands afterward, she advises. Kissing and more intimate physical contact is perfectly fine. Male chemo patients, however, should use a condom for the first 48 hours after a chemo treatment, she notes. cancer cancer treatment chemotherapy radiation
